Early Life and Education
Elon Reeve Musk was born on June 28, 1971, in Pretoria, South Africa. He is a business magnate, investor, and philanthropist. Musk is the founder, CEO, and chief engineer of SpaceX; angel investor, CEO, and product architect of Tesla, Inc.; owner, CEO, and CTO of Twitter; founder of The Boring Company; co-founder of Neuralink and OpenAI; and president of the Musk Foundation.
Musk spent his childhood in South Africa and briefly attended the University of Pretoria before moving to Canada at age 17. He enrolled at Queen's University and transferred to the University of Pennsylvania, where he received bachelor's degrees in economics and physics.
Career
Tesla Motors
Musk joined Tesla Motors (now Tesla, Inc.) in 2004 as chairman and product architect, becoming its CEO in 2008. Under his leadership, Tesla has become a leading manufacturer of electric vehicles, solar panels, and battery storage systems. The company has revolutionized the automotive industry with its innovative technology and sustainable energy solutions.
SpaceX
In 2002, Musk founded Space Exploration Technologies Corp. (SpaceX) with the goal of reducing space transportation costs and enabling the colonization of Mars. SpaceX has developed the Falcon rocket family and the Dragon spacecraft, which became the first commercial spacecraft to deliver cargo to the International Space Station.
